Requirements:
3 APs, each with:
- at least one gigabit port, but 5 gigabit ports preferred (this is why the hAP AC Lite is not sufficient)
- dual chain 2.4GHz N
- dual or triple chain 5GHz AC
- all will be indoors, and do not require POE In. aesthetics are a minor concern.
Option 1: RB922UAGS-5HPacD with R11e-2HPnD and CA411-711
Ethernet: 1xgigabit plus SFP
2.4GHz: dual chain 1000mW
5GHz: dual chain 1300mW (frankly a bit too powerful, but I can turn that down)
approx. cost, excluding antennas: $99 + $39 + $15 = $153
Option 2: RB922UAGS-5HPacT-NM with R11e-2HPnD (this is only an option because the RB922UAGS-5HPacT does not appear to be available outside of the NetMetal case)
Ethernet: 1xgigabit plus SFP
2.4GHz: dual chain 1000mW
5GHz: triple chain “high power” (power not specified, assuming 1000mW or 1300mW)
approx. cost, excluding antennas: $159 + $39 = $198
Option 3: RB912UAG-2HPnD-OUT with R11e-5HacT
Ethernet: 1xgigabit
2.4GHz: dual chain 1000mW
5GHz: triple chain 630mW
approx. cost, excluding antennas: $89 + $59 = $148 (substitute RB912UAG-2HPnD and CA411-711 for $5 more - looks better for indoors IMO)
the RB912UAG-5HPnD / BaseBox 5 is basically the same option here, but would limit be to dual chain 5GHz.
for antennas, I was just going to use ACOMNIRPSMA with ACMMCXRPSMA (for BaseBox of NetMetal), or ACSWIM (for CA411-711).
so option 1 and option 3 end up coming out to the same cost if using the CA411-711 enclosure, and the tradeoff is an SFP cage versus triple chain wireless. the 922 has twice the RAM, but I’m just using these as dumb APs, the most they’ll do is per SSID VLAN tagging.
